What companies run services between Foz do Douro, Portugal and São Bento Station, Porto, Portugal?

STCP operates a bus from Passeio Alegre to Porto - São Bento every 30 minutes.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 15 min. Alternatively, STCP operates a vehicle from Passeio Alegre to Clérigos hourly. Tickets cost €6 and the journey takes 25 min.
